What Is Noggin?
Noggin is a comprehensive resilience software solution tailored for organizations aiming to oversee operational, security, and crisis-related risks. This platform consolidates business continuity, operational resilience, incident and crisis management, emergency response, and safety operations into one cohesive workspace.
It provides teams with pre-configured workflows, templates, dashboards, and the ability to customize without coding. This ensures that processes are coordinated effectively, incidents are tracked efficiently, and information is shared seamlessly.
Noggin Pricing
Our estimates indicate that the starting price for Noggin is approximately $10,000 per year. Beyond the core subscription fee, organizations should be prepared for typical implementation and operational expenses based on industry standards. For a medium to large enterprise, one-time setup and professional services might amount to about $82,000. Ongoing licensing and support could reach around $294,000 over a three-year period, while internal training and maintenance may require an estimated $148,000.
For precise pricing tailored to your organization’s requirements, it is advisable to request a customized quote for Noggin.
Note: Pricing information is derived from publicly accessible third-party data and industry benchmarks. Actual costs may differ.

Is Noggin Right For You?
Noggin is well-suited for organizations that require a consolidated platform for resilience, crisis management, and security across various sectors including transportation, healthcare, or government. It integrates ten essential resilience solutions with customizable workflows, mobile access, and strong security features. Designed to adhere to global standards, Noggin aids organizations in meeting compliance requirements such as ISO 22308, ISO 45001, ISO 31000, ISO 22301, ISO 22320, NIMS, ICS, ISO 27001, among others. This enables enterprises to operate at scale while ensuring reliable compliance and governance.
